The Bosch Rexroth Indramat SF-A2.0020.030-14.050 is part of the SF Servo Motors series and features a flange size of 100 mm and a motor length with brake of 217 mm. It has a rated speed of 3000 min^-1 and a holding brake torque of 3.2 Nm. The motor operates at a DC link voltage of 670 V and weighs 5.8 kilograms with the brake.

Product Description:

The SF-A2.0020.030-14.050 is a permanent-magnet synchronous servo motor manufactured by Bosch Rexroth Indramat within the SF Servo Motors series. Designed as a compact drive element for precise positioning, it converts commanded current from a compatible Rexroth inverter into controlled rotary motion used in pick-and-place units, gantries, and other cyclic axes on automated lines. The motor couples directly to machine frames, eliminating intermediate belts and gears, and reports operating data through internal sensors so that the drive controller can close a high-resolution torque and speed loop.

The motor mounts to standard mechanical interfaces because its flange measures 100 mm. During continuous operation, the rotor reaches a rated shaft velocity of 3000 rpm, a range suited to medium-speed packaging and handling tasks. A torque constant of 1.5 Nm/A links drive current to usable shaft torque, helping the controller calculate acceleration limits. The power stage is supplied from a DC bus of 670 V, so cable insulation and connector spacing must match this potential. When the shaft is locked, the electromagnetic structure can withstand a stall load of 2.0 Nm and draws 1.3 A, indicating the startup load placed on the drive. Two integrated NTC temperature sensors report winding temperature, and a permissible 5% brake ripple limits residual torque pulsations.

With the holding brake assembled, the housing length is 217 mm and the total mass is 5.8 kg, so compact pick-and-place axes can still meet low moving-mass targets. The spring-applied brake clamps the shaft with a static torque of 3.2 Nm. Once power is restored, the coil releases when a supply of 24 VDC is applied and 0.56 A flows. The brake components add 0.35 kg to the rotor and introduce 0.4 × 10⁻⁴ kg·m² of additional inertia, figures the motion controller must include in jerk calculations.
